1) Case / issue gets created / reported
2) Test the issue in your test account -- see if you can reproduce what the customer is reporting.
If you can reproduce -> it is likely a bug, unless our software is meant to work that way, in which case it is a customer expectation issue.
Once you have identified the bug, create an issue in JIRA:
-Include steps to reproduce (STR), you should have these from step 2 above
-Talk to Brian / Matt and see what sprint it should go in, and who to assign the JIRA item to.
If you cannot reproduce in your test account, try in customers account.
If you can reproduce in customers account it might be a configuration issue - Sage and/or Heather might be the best to talk to in this case.
Once you rule out config issues, then open a JIRA bug, and follow the instructions above.
